Fort Saskatchewan welcomes you

Welcome to Fort Saskatchewan! As a newcomer we know you have lots of questions. We have resources, services, and programs to help!

Services and programs are available to everyone; you do not need a library card. However to access all of our online and physical resources, you need a library card.

Our Settlement Services Practitioners connect newcomers to available services and resources in the community. In partnership with the Edmonton Immigrant Services Association.

"Job Search Strategies, That Work"

Free Online Teaching Tool - Job Search Strategies That Work

Designed to support newcomers with essential information and skills to effectively prepare, search and obtain employment, www.canemploy.ca is free to all newcomers! Watch free videos that cover key topics on:

  1. Resume Development
  2. Cover Letter
  3. References
  4. LinkedIn
  5. Labour Market Information
  6. Job Search Strategies and Methods
  7. Networking and Mentorship
  8. Job Interview Preparation
  9. Job Interview Strategies
